Until May 30th, the Ronchèse school will exhibit its award-winning project “Beauty of Waste” at the House of the Environment, which was funded by the Environmental Trophies of the city of Nice*.
Winners of the 9th Environmental Trophies of the city of Nice, the students of Ronchèse school, from kindergarten to grade 5, offer to showcase their solutions for waste revalorization.
What solutions?
How to better sort to better recycle, valorize waste, and preserve our environment?
How to change our perspective on the end of life of everyday objects or products that have become waste?
Sculptures, poems, drawings, artworks, photos… a whole universe on “the beauty of waste.”
*Since the first edition of the Environmental Trophies, the City of Nice has received 529 applications, 240 projects have been selected, and 192 already executed for a total amount allocated by the city of €390,937.
